Celebrating its 50th year, the Food Northwest Process and Packaging Expo is the largest regional food manufacturing trade show in the United States. This convention brings industry professionals together, including Janna Hamlett and Catherine Cantley of TechHelp and the Universit of Idaho, for two full days of education, equipment and service solutions, and networking opportunities. The exhibit hall showcases cutting-edge technologies and new innovations, production line equipment, packaging, hygiene and much more.

The event will host world-class education specifically chosen by food processor members to support training needs and to address timely issues and challenges of the food processing industry. The Hazard Analysis and Critical Control Points (HACCP) system is a logical, scientific approach to controlling hazards in food production and is a preventive system assuring the safe production of food products. The principle of HACCP can be applied to production, meat slaughter and processing, shipping and distribution, food service, and home preparation.

Successful completion of this course will result in an Introduction to HACCP Certificate with the International HACCP Alliance seal of approval.
